diff options
author | Rainer Gerhards <rgerhards@adiscon.com> | 2009-07-10 13:57:34 +0200 |
---|---|---|
committer | Rainer Gerhards <rgerhards@adiscon.com> | 2009-07-10 13:57:34 +0200 |
commit | 7eb5a5c5bd74ef43c8dc3331bac6dc48d9e6d825 (patch) | |
tree | df6ef116cdc6399671542977014f5c5e6a27386c | |
parent | 6fde78cb744b22eb5790d43297acab249ca0e7fa (diff) | |
parent | 6fff4ae3329e852586f3a14ac8b8369bc6d61148 (diff) | |
download | rsyslog-7eb5a5c5bd74ef43c8dc3331bac6dc48d9e6d825.tar.gz rsyslog-7eb5a5c5bd74ef43c8dc3331bac6dc48d9e6d825.tar.xz rsyslog-7eb5a5c5bd74ef43c8dc3331bac6dc48d9e6d825.zip |
Merge branch 'v4-beta' into v4-devel
-rw-r--r-- | ChangeLog | 2 | ||||
-rw-r--r-- | runtime/parser.c | 1 |
2 files changed, 2 insertions, 1 deletions
@@ -1,5 +1,7 @@ --------------------------------------------------------------------------- Version 4.5.1 [DEVEL] (rgerhards), 2009-07-?? +- bugfix: potential segfault when zip-compressed syslog records were + received (double free) - bugfix: properties inputname, fromhost, fromhost-ip, msg were lost when working with disk queues - performance enhancement: much faster, up to twice as fast (depending diff --git a/runtime/parser.c b/runtime/parser.c index a5183105..a2538fa3 100644 --- a/runtime/parser.c +++ b/runtime/parser.c @@ -115,7 +115,6 @@ static inline rsRetVal uncompressMessage(msg_t *pMsg) FINALIZE; /* unconditional exit, nothing left to do... */ } MsgSetRawMsg(pMsg, (char*)deflateBuf, iLenDefBuf); - free(deflateBuf); } finalize_it: if(deflateBuf != NULL) |